The Secret: Throw the puffer into the dryer on a low setting on its own, adding a few tennis balls to the machine. While the jacket dries, the tennis balls will bounce around the machine, constantly hitting the jacket like you would fluff a pillow back into shape.
How do you fix a puffer jacket after washing it?
You can pinch the baffles and manipulate the down this way. Place your item into a tumble drier on a low heat/gentle setting (this is very important as a high heat setting can damage or even melt the lightweight fabric) Every 20-30 mins remove the jacket and turn inside out to promote even drying.

How do you make puffer jackets puffy?
The Secret: Throw the puffer into the dryer on a low setting on its own, adding a few tennis balls to the machine. While the jacket dries, the tennis balls will bounce around the machine, constantly hitting the jacket like you would fluff a pillow back into shape.

What can I use in dryer instead of tennis balls?
Instead of using a tennis ball, other objects can produce the same results. Tie a couple of T-shirts into balls and put them in the dryer with a single pillow. Add in a single clean shoe with multiple pillows. Small stuffed animals without any plastic parts can fluff the pillows and keep the dryer quiet.
Can I put my puffer coat in the washing machine?
How to Wash Puffer Jackets. Use a front-loading or newer top-loading machine to wash your puffer jacket, or hand wash if necessary. Typically, these types of washing machines don't have the center agitator that can catch and tear materials, like the delicate top layer of a puffer coat.

How can I make my North Face puffy again?
After washing your jacket, the down can clump together inside the lining. To fix this issue, dry your garment on a low heat setting, adding some tennis balls or dryer balls. The balls will separate and fluff up the feathers as they dry, maintaining their insulating properties.
Can you put a North Face puffer jacket in the washing machine?
Wash Your North Face Puffer Jacket
It is recommended to use a front load washing machine because there is no center agitator, which can damage the jacket's structure. Wash the jacket in warm water using the gentle cycle. It is also important that you also use a gentle powder detergent instead of liquid.
Can you tumble dry a puffer jacket?
Dry the Jacket
A down jacket should not be air dried. Not only will air drying take a very long time there is more risk of the feathers clumping together and the jacket starting to smell (if it takes a while to dry). Down jackets should be tumble dried at a low heat.

How do you make homemade dryer balls?
Save money by making your own DIY Homemade Dryer Balls
- You will need: Wool Yarn, Nylon Hose, Twist Ties (optional) and a Washing Machine.
- Roll yarn into a ball.
- Cut off the pants part of the hose.
- Place yarn balls inside hose and secure with knot or twist tie.
- Wash in machine with hot water until yarn is completely felted.
Will tennis balls ruin my dryer?
It's possible that some tennis balls, especially newer ones, might transfer their neon dye to items filled with down. Depending on the dryer cycle and temperature level you select, the tennis ball might not be able to withstand the heat. Using tennis balls in dryer machines can be very loud.

How do you wash a North Face puffer?
Wash in warm water with a mild powder detergent (without bleach) on a gentle cycle. You may wish to repeat the rinse cycle to be sure all soap residue is removed. An extra spin cycle will help to remove excess water. Do not lift the product from the washer; scoop it from the bottom.

How do you hand wash a puffer?
Hand Wash
- Grab a bathtub or large bucket.
- Fill with warm water and a specialty down cleaner.
- Submerge your jacket and get your hands in there. ...
- Get rid of the dirty water, then rinse. ...
- Hang to dry.
- Down can clump up when it's wet, so don't just run off, return every so often to unclump the down with your hands.
Does washing a down jacket ruin it?
Most backpackers are afraid to wash down because they think getting down wet will ruin it, but that's not actually true. You can (and should) wash your down sleeping bag as well. When down gets wet it clumps together and loses its loft, so it performs poorly at holding in heat.
Can you put down jackets in the dryer?
By far the best way to dry your down jacket is in the dryer. Dry the down jacket in a dryer with a drum large enough so air can circulate around it. Set the dryer to low or air dry. Toss in a few dryer balls or clean tennis balls to keep the item tumbling and prevent down from clumping.
How do you Unclump down?
I've found this works very well:
- Wash it on gentle cycle with a down specific detergent in a machine that doesn't have an agitator (you don't want to rip the baffles)
- Extra rinse & spin cycle to get all of the detergent out.
- Dry on low heat with tennis balls until all of the down is completely unclumped.

Does adding a dry towel in the dryer help?
Throwing a dry towel in the dryer with the wet clothes absorbs most of the moisture, making your items dry faster. Not only does the method cut down on the drying time, the process uses less energy so you're likely to save some money along the way.
